Problem

Conventional game systems require users to individually specify each component for changes in virtual structures, making the process complex and burdensome.

Innovation Solution

A program and system that acquires item information, forms virtual structures, selects items of a common variation based on user input, and replaces portions of the structures when certain conditions are met, simplifying the operation in virtual spaces.

AI summary

A program is provided for causing a computer providing a virtual space (VS) to function as: an acquiring unit that acquires item information regarding a plurality of items used by an object (O) operated by a user in the virtual space (VS); a formation unit that forms one or more virtual structures based on the plurality of items; a selecting unit that selects items of a common variation VR associated with the plurality of items, based on a user input; and a replacement unit that replaces at least a portion of the plurality of items forming the one or more virtual structures with items of the common variation VR, when the plurality of items satisfy a predetermined condition. This program provides an information processing technique that improves users' convenience regarding their operation on virtual structures in a virtual space.
